From a5e6af5bff44d950f518625616cbfd3926694e68 Mon Sep 17 00:00:00 2001 From: Peter Hutterer Date: Mon, 7 Mar 2022 11:18:47 +1000 Subject: [PATCH] eis: after the client binds the seat, drop the capabilities This way eis_seat_has_capability() returns the effective capabilities the server can actually use - no point creating touch devices when the client has not confirmed that. In theory we should have a eis_seat_get_effective_capabilities() to differ between configured and effective capabilities, but I'm having a hard time thinking of a use-case where the implementation forgets which caps it enabled.
